The Ultimate Guide to Computers: From Thier Fascinating History to the Latest Applications
![]() |
Introduction:
Computers have become ubiquitous in modern society, touching virtually every aspect of our lives. From work to entertainment, education to communication, computers have transformed the way we live, learn, and work. But what exactly are computers, and how did they come to be such an essential part of our daily existence? In this essay, we will provide a comprehensive overview of computers, including their history, types, components, applications, advantages, and challenges.
History of Computers:
Types of Computers:
Personal computers (PCs): These are the most common type of computer, designed for individual use in homes, offices, and schools. They typically consist of a monitor, a keyboard, a mouse, and a system unit that contains the CPU, memory, and storage devices.
Laptops: Also known as notebook computers, laptops are portable PCs that can be carried around and used on the go. They are similar to desktop PCs in terms of their components, but they are designed to be more compact and lightweight.
Tablets: These are handheld computers that are designed primarily for web browsing, email, and multimedia consumption. They are typically equipped with touchscreens and can run a variety of apps.
Servers: These are powerful computers that are used to store and manage large amounts of data, typically in a networked environment. They are designed to provide reliable and secure access to data and services for multiple users.
Supercomputers: These are the most powerful computers available, used for complex scientific and engineering calculations. They are typically used by governments and large corporations for tasks such as weather forecasting, nuclear simulations, and financial modeling.
Components of Computers:
Central processing unit (CPU): This is the "brain" of the computer, responsible for executing instructions and performing calculations.
Memory: This is where the computer stores data and instructions temporarily while they are being processed.
Storage devices: These are used to store data permanently, even when the computer is turned off. Common types of storage devices include hard disk drives (HDDs) and solid-state drives (SSDs).
Input devices: These are used to enter data into the computer, such as keyboards, mice, and touchscreens.
Output devices: These are used to display data that has been processed by the computer, such as monitors, printers, and speakers.
Applications of Computers:
Computers have countless applications in modern society, includingEducation: Computers are used extensively in schools and universities for tasks such as research, writing, and online learning.
Business: Computers are used in virtually every aspect of business, from accounting and finance to marketing and sales.
Entertainment: Computers are used for gaming, streaming video and music, and social media.
Science and engineering: Computers are used extensively in scientific research and engineering, from modeling and simulation to data analysis and visualization.
Healthcare: Computers are used in healthcare for tasks such as patient record keeping, diagnostics, and research.
Communication: Computers are integral to communication, from email and messaging to video conferencing and social media.
Transportation: Computers are used in transportation for tasks such as traffic control, navigation, and logistics.
Finance: Computers are essential in finance for tasks such as online banking, stock trading, and risk management.
Security: Computers are used for security in tasks such as surveillance, biometrics, and cryptography.
Artificial Intelligence: The field of artificial intelligence is entirely based on the use of computers to simulate human intelligence and to develop intelligent systems that can perform complex tasks.
In addition to these applications, computers are used in many other fields and industries, and their versatility makes them an essential tool in modern society.
Types of Computers:
There are several types of computers, each designed for different purposes and with varying capabilities. Some of the most common types of computers include:
Personal computers (PCs): PCs are designed for individual use and are typically used for tasks such as web browsing, word processing, and gaming.
Laptops: Laptops are portable computers designed for easy transport and use on the go. They have become increasingly popular due to their convenience and versatility.
Tablets: Tablets are similar to laptops but are designed for more mobile use, with a touchscreen interface and a longer battery life.
Servers: Servers are designed to manage networks and provide centralized storage and processing power for multiple users and devices.
Mainframes: Mainframes are large computers designed for high-speed data processing and storage. They are often used in large organizations and government agencies.
Supercomputers: Supercomputers are the most powerful and advanced computers, designed for complex calculations and data processing. They are used in fields such as weather forecasting, scientific research, and aerospace engineering.
Computer Hardware:
Computer hardware refers to the physical components of a computer, including the central processing unit (CPU), memory, storage devices, and input/output devices. The CPU is the "brain" of the computer, responsible for executing instructions and performing calculations. Memory refers to the temporary storage space used by the CPU to process data. Storage devices, such as hard drives and solid-state drives, are used to store data and programs long-term. Input/output devices, such as keyboards, mice, and monitors, allow users to interact with and receive information from the computer.
Computer Software:
Computer software refers to the programs and applications that run on a computer, enabling it to perform specific tasks. Operating systems, such as Windows, macOS, and Linux, provide a platform for other software programs to run on. Applications, such as web browsers, word processors, and media players, provide specific functions for users to perform.
Programming:
Programming refers to the process of creating software programs and applications using programming languages. Programming languages, such as Python, Java, and C++, provide a set of instructions for the computer to execute. Programmers use these languages to create software that can perform specific tasks, such as analyzing data, playing games, or controlling hardware.
Computer Networks:
Computer networks refer to the connection of multiple computers and devices, allowing them to communicate and share resources. Networks can be classified into different types based on their size, geographical coverage, and purpose.
One of the most common types of computer networks is the local area network (LAN), which connects devices within a small geographical area, such as a building or campus. LANs are often used in homes, schools, and offices to enable file sharing, internet connectivity, and printer access.
Another type of network is the wide area network (WAN), which spans across a large geographic area, such as a country or continent. WANs connect LANs and enable remote access to resources and services.
Wireless networks, such as Wi-Fi and Bluetooth, use radio waves to transmit data between devices without the need for physical cables. These networks are popular in homes, cafes, and public places where users need to connect to the internet or share files without being tethered to a physical connection.
Computer networks are essential in modern society and play a critical role in enabling communication, data sharing, and resource access. They are used in a variety of settings, including homes, schools, businesses, hospitals, and government agencies.
0 Comments